The Visual Character of Tropic Fantasy
At its core, Tropic Fantasy is defined by its refined letterforms. Unlike rigid, geometric sans serif fonts or overly ornate script fonts, this serif font relies on subtle details to create its personality. The strokes are elegant, featuring the classic thick-to-thin transitions associated with high-end typography, but they are rendered with a softness that makes the text feel welcoming.
The overall aesthetic is one of "classic charm with contemporary flair." It avoids looking dated or stuffy, which is often a risk with traditional serif typefaces. Instead, it feels fresh and versatile. The characters have a natural rhythm that guides the eye along the page, making it an excellent choice for display use where you want the headlines to capture attention immediately. It is the kind of font that suggests quality and care, making it a valuable premium font for any creative professional.

Mastering Font Pairing
One of the most important skills in design is font pairing. Because Tropic Fantasy has a strong personality, it pairs best with something more neutral. A clean sans serif font for body text often creates the perfect contrast. The sans serif provides a modern, clean baseline for long paragraphs, while Tropic Fantasy handles the heavy lifting for headlines and sub-headers. This contrast creates a clear hierarchy, making your designs easier to scan and more visually interesting.
Ensuring Readability and Hierarchy
While Tropic Fantasy is a creative font, you must always prioritize readability. It shines brightest as a display font—meaning it is best used for larger text sizes like titles, headers, and logos. While it can work for shorter blocks of body text, be sure to test it at the specific size you intend to use. Good design is about guiding the viewer's eye; use this font to establish the main points, and let a simpler typeface handle the details.
Licensing and Technical Considerations
Before you finalize your project, always review the commercial licensing details. A commercial font like Tropic Fantasy usually requires a specific license depending on the use case—whether it is for a single client, a website, or a mass-produced physical product. Ensure you have the correct license to avoid legal issues down the road. Additionally, check what styles are included (e.g., bold, italic, light). Having multiple weights gives you more flexibility to create emphasis and variety within your designs without introducing a new typeface.
